## Service Accounts: Stale-Cache Postmortem

During the Quillbarrow incident, plugin service accounts kept resolving to revoked tokens because the Fenwick cache layer ignored TTL headers. The fix shipped in gateway v4.2; plugin authors should now re-fetch credentials on any 401 rather than retrying. To validate your plugin against the patched staging gateway, authenticate with the key below.

service key, fawip-bajef: kto11_Qt5wZK9vdNC

- [ ] Step 7: Archive cold storage buckets (Glacierline tier). Confirm both ceremony witnesses are present, verify bucket manifests match the Oxbow ledger, then seal the archive key shares. Plugin authors may observe but not handle shares. Once sealed, the archive index itself is encrypted and can only be reopened with the passphrase below.

vault phrase of badup-hahig = tamael-aldael-kelmir-istael-fenok-istwyn-tamius-jorath-oliion

- [ ] **Step 7: Breaker override escrow.** After sealing the signing keys for the Tallgrove upstream API circuit breaker, confirm the support team can force the breaker open during a full outage. The override bundle lives in the sealed escrow drawer and is useless without its unlock phrase. Two ceremony witnesses must initial this step before proceeding. The escrow bundle is decrypted with the recovery passphrase that follows.

vault phrase of kahip-kahop = holath-quenmir

### Account Recovery — Catalogue Import (Lintwood)

Quick one for review: when the Lintwood catalogue import wipes a patron's session table, the recovery flow re-seeds accounts from the nightly snapshot. Check that the importer skips locked accounts — last time it didn't. To rerun recovery against staging you'll need the vault passphrase, which is appended just below.

recovery phrase for yafof-tajof: julmir-kelax-julvan-holath-belvan-holir-ralael-ralvan-ralath-julvan-silmir-istmir-kaswyn-ulamir